How does the seadeck / aquatraction do with dog paws?

I avoided the seadeck Idea so far because everyone says it gets really hot, and that the glue is a mess. The snap in looks like the best of everything.
 
I got as many samples as I could including SeaDeck and AquaTraction. I submitted all to 24 hour red wine soaking, simulated dog claws, heavy duty cleaners, and heat retention by placing out in the hot sun.

Both SeaDeck and AquaTraction stood up well to the cleaners. Both also did on with my simulated dog paws. SD stained slightly from the red wine while AT did not. SD was HOT, AT was warm. From the research I have done, the major reason I chose AT glue down was the heat retention and the shrinking issue that SD has. The shrinkage is what causes the glue issue.

Sea deck is crap! Everything the warranty excluded happenedIMG_0702.jpgIMG_0704.JPGIMG_0705.JPG the first 3 months. Curled up, shrank, pattern disappeared. Funny ha ha the boat was in the same slip the install was done in. Took me 3 weeks doing 1 sq ft at a time to get the transfer glue off my non skid when I ripped it out! Went with snap in Infiniti marine. About the same price but still looks great.

Have you already pulled the trigger? A couple weeks ago I had SeaDek installed on my 2005 34 PC. These aren't the best pics but you will get an idea of how awesome this stuff is!

After doing a TON of research, I decided to pay a little extra and purchase the Snap-In and NOT the glue down. EVERYONE I spoken to that installed the glue down has issues with certain area coming up or needing more glue. The Snap-In is AWESOME and if I ever wanted to remove it, it takes 2 minutes......AND cleaning it and under it is super easy. Oh and with the snap-on the material is MUCH thicker and it feels great under your feet!
